Title:
  Crash/black screen when suspend

Status in linux package in Ubuntu:
  Confirmed

Bug description:
  Suspend does not fully work: The screen goes to black and then
  crashes. Ctrl+Alt+Del does not work, neither switching to any other
  tty.
